What’s Happening?
The Chicago White Sox are playing the Los Angeles Angels, leading the series 1-0. The White Sox, with a 41-69 record, take on the Angels, who have a 53-57 record. Monday’s game promises another thrilling encounter.
Where Is It Happening?
Angel Stadium, Anaheim, California
When Did It Take Place?
Monday, July 25, 2023, 10:07 p.m. EDT

Quick Breakdown
- Series Lead: White Sox 1-0
- White Sox’s Record: 41-69 (fifth in AL Central)
- Angels’ Record: 53-57 (fourth in AL West)
- White Sox’s Probable Pitcher: Aaron Civale (2-6, 4.38 ERA)
